Abstract
To increase the network lifetime and to save energy clustering method can be used as in most multi hop networks Cluster top being near to primary stations use more energy because of elevated inter cluster communicate traffic load resulting in Hop spot difficulty. By select an Extra CH named as Surrogate Cluster Head (SCH) in order to restore network connectivity which is interrupted because of failure of MCH, this method uses TDMA to allot time slots.
